    Esri::ArcGISRuntime::TaskWatcher FeatureTable::addFeature(Esri::ArcGISRuntime::Feature *feature)

    This function is deprecated. We strongly advise against using it in new code.

    Adds a new feature to the feature table and returns a TaskWatcher for the asynchronous operation.

    Adding a feature that contains a Geometry causes the geometry to become simplified. This may change a single part geometry to a multipart geometry, or round off X, Y, Z, and M coordinate values that are above the resolution set by the SpatialReference.

    Adding a feature to a GeodatabaseFeatureTable in a stand-alone mobile geodatabase created with ArcGIS Pro is not supported when the table participates in a controller dataset, such as a utility network or parcel fabric. Use canAdd to determine if this operation is allowed.

    Esri::ArcGISRuntime::TaskWatcher FeatureTable::updateFeature(Esri::ArcGISRuntime::Feature *feature)

    This function is deprecated. We strongly advise against using it in new code.

    Updates a feature in the feature table and returns a TaskWatcher for the asynchronous operation.

    Updating a feature that contains a Geometry causes the geometry to become simplified. This may change a single-part geometry to a multipart geometry, or round off x, y, z, and m-coordinate values that are above the resolution set by the SpatialReference.

    Updating a feature from a GeodatabaseFeatureTable in a stand-alone mobile geodatabase created with ArcGIS Pro is not supported when the table participates in a controller dataset, such as a utility network or parcel fabric. Use FeatureTable::canUpdate to determine if this operation is allowed.
